Charles "Chuck" Prophet Dies

Charles “Chuck” Prophet, a trendsetting athletic and sports information director for Mississippi Valley State University, has died. He was 67 years old. Prophet was a long standing member of several sports information director societies, serving as president of the Black College Sports Information Directors Association, and as a board member with the College Sports Information [...]
